    Hey guys I have 1956 f250 with the 292 and t98 from a 63or 64 can't remember...I'm looking for the rear brake shoes and the hardware kit with all the springs etc..I have the wheel cylinders. Just can't locate the wheel seals and 2 inch shoes with out paying am arm and a leg. It's a dana 60 8 lug with 2 inch shoes thanks dan

    rock auto has shoes and seals, they don't list the hardware, but you might be able to find the parts at your local auto supply place if you know what you're looking for. I just reuse the hardware, unless something is obviously wore out or missing or broke. If it uses normal Bendix type hardware, you should be able to find it listed for a later truck with 12" brakes
